THE HILL TIMES | Personalized medicine is the future of health care

Published: 5 February 2019

It’s small wonder that buying drugs is expensive. The federal government is consulting on whether a national pharmacare program can reduce costs, while providing coverage to vulnerable populations. But there is a complementary avenue to be explored that promises to lower healthcare costs and revitalize Canada’s pharmaceutical industry—personalized medicine.

Op-ed by Philippe Gros, deputy vice-principal, research and innovation, McGill University, and Officer of the Order of Canada and Mark Lathrop, professor of Human Genetics, and director of the McGill and Genome Quebec Innovation Center.
